Dark green (#06402B) embodies sophistication and natural depth, making it a powerful tool in modern design. This rich, earthy shade sits at the cooler end of the green spectrum with subtle undertones that evoke the dense foliage of ancient forests.
In design psychology, dark green promotes feelings of groundedness and stability while encouraging renewal and growth. Its deep hue naturally creates a sense of balance, making it ideal for luxury interfaces where emerald green might feel too vibrant or forest green too muted.
Designers frequently leverage dark green to convey exclusivity and premium quality. When paired with gold or cream accents, it creates sophisticated atmospheres perfect for high-end products or memberships. The color also excels in eco-conscious applications, naturally connecting users to sustainability and environmental values.
For optimal accessibility, ensure sufficient contrast when using dark green as backgrounds. Pair it with light neutrals like antique white or silver for readable interfaces. Consider hunter green for slightly lighter variations, or explore complementary colors like beige to soften its intensity while maintaining its grounded, natural appeal.
Hex
#06402B
RGB
6,64,43
HSB
158, 91%, 25%
HSL
158, 83%, 14%
